Biography of Prince Louis

Born on April 23, 2018, Prince Louis Arthur Charles is the youngest son of the Duke and Duchess of Cambridge, Prince William and Catherine Middleton. He has two older siblings, Prince George and Princess Charlotte. Louis's birth was celebrated by the public, as he added to the lineage of the British royal family.

What is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D)?

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) is a complex neurodevelopmental condition characterized by a range of symptoms, including challenges in communication, social interactions, and repetitive behaviors. The severity of autism can vary widely among individuals, making it a spectrum disorder. Some common signs of autism include:

  • Difficulty in understanding social cues
  • Challenges in verbal and nonverbal communication
  • Repetitive behaviors or interests
  • Sensitivity to sensory input
  • Difficulty with transitions and changes in routine

Diagnosing autism typically involves a comprehensive evaluation by healthcare professionals, including developmental assessments and behavioral observations. Early intervention can significantly improve outcomes for children with autism, allowing them to develop skills and strategies for navigating the world.
